Beans and Cornbread


I went to my in-laws this weekend. They live in the country--God's country, y'all--picture horse trailers hitched to muddy pickups, hay bales, and tobacco hanging up in the barn to dry.

In any case, I think I might have gained roughly five pounds in two days. We drove over to the next little town and ate at Cathy's Country Cupboard and let me tell you, it was some good, down home, stick-to-your-ribs kinda cookin'! We had a mess o' fried catfish, white beans, coleslaw, fried potatoes, cornbread, and sweet tea. I have to say that the white beans surprised me. I'm used to pintos (you know, cook 'em up low and slow with some ham hocks or fatback), but these white beans were even better. And then the desserts ... Lord have mercy! This old country gal named Frieda comes in early in the morning and makes all the pies and cobblers from scratch. Coconut pie, pecan pie, peach cobbler, lemon meringue pie, and blackberry cobbler were the selections when I went. Frieda makes what she wants to make. The blackberry cobbler had big, fat, fresh blackberries all through it and the crust was perfection. Frieda is an artist.

That was just one meal. I'm not going to get into the biscuits and sausage gravy, grits, and hashbrowns that happened at breakfast. I'm going to have to eat nothing but salad for days just to get the gravy out of my bloodstream. It was totally worth it though.

Made in the USA


My biggest complaint with all the home shopping channels is their affinity for all things manufactured in China (and other countries with cheap labor and low standards). In these horrible economic times, I want to support American jobs whenever I can.

But what can I do about it?

Since I don't have the power to change everything, I'll just do what I can. Hey, we're all in this together, right? I certainly don't want everyone to just stop buying from these homes shopping companies so they are forced go out of business. They provide many American jobs (although the number has been shrinking lately) and endless hours of entertainment.

So I decided that I'm going to try to spotlight great items made right here. If you're already in the market to buy, you might as well support American companies with your purchase.
